Why SIM Registration Is Important
SIM registration is required under Philippine law to improve mobile security and reduce scams.
It helps:
- Prevent spam and fraud
- Protect users from identity misuse
- Improve tracking of illegal activities
All prepaid and postpaid users are required to register their SIM cards.
SIM Registration Requirements Philippines
Before registering, prepare the following:
- Valid government-issued ID
- Full name and birthday
- Active mobile number
- Selfie photo for verification
Make sure your information is correct and matches your ID.
How to Register SIM Card Philippines
Smart and TNT SIM Registration
Smart and TNT users can register online using the official portal.
Official registration website:
https://simreg.smart.com.ph/
Steps for Smart and TNT Users
- Visit the official registration website
- Enter your mobile number
- Input the OTP sent to your SIM
- Fill out your personal information
- Upload your valid ID and selfie
- Submit your registration
You will receive confirmation once registration is successful.


Globe and TM SIM Registration
Globe and TM users can register using Globe’s official registration website.
Official registration website:
https://www.globe.com.ph/register-sim-card
Steps for Globe and TM Users
- Open the Globe SIM registration website
- Enter your mobile number
- Verify using the OTP
- Complete your personal details
- Upload your ID and selfie
- Submit the registration form
Always double-check your information before submitting.



DITO SIM Registration
DITO users need to register using the official DITO mobile app.
Official app page:
https://dito.ph/app-landing
Steps for DITO Users
- Download and install the DITO app
- Open the app and create an account if needed
- Enter your DITO mobile number
- Fill out the required personal information
- Upload your valid ID and selfie
- Submit your registration through the app
Using the official app helps ensure a safer and smoother registration process.

Common SIM Registration Problems
Some users experience issues during registration.
Common problems include:
- Blurry ID uploads
- OTP not received
- Weak internet connection
- Incorrect information
Most issues can be solved by retrying with a stable connection and clearer photos.
What Happens If You Don’t Register Your SIM?
Unregistered SIM cards may be deactivated.
Once deactivated:
- Calls and texts stop working
- Mobile data becomes unavailable
- Your number may become unusable
To avoid inconvenience, register your SIM as soon as possible.

FAQs
Is SIM registration mandatory in the Philippines?
Yes, all SIM users are required to register their SIM cards.
Can I register my SIM online?
Yes. Smart, TNT, Globe, and TM users can register online, while DITO users register through the official app.
What IDs are accepted for SIM registration?
Government-issued IDs such as UMID, passport, driver’s license, and PhilHealth ID are commonly accepted.
How long does SIM registration take?
It usually takes only a few minutes if your requirements are complete.
What happens if I don’t register my SIM?
Your SIM may be deactivated, which means you can no longer use calls, texts, or mobile data.
